By numerical backward integration of stellar motions in the Galaxy it is found that 55 cepheids probably originated in the Sagittarius arm and in the Perseus arm if only the spiral field of the density wave is included. This confirms the linear theory of density waves. The amplitude of this wave is ≡10 per cent of the mean galactic field, and the pattern speed is 15 km/s kpc. It is shown that the result of calculations is not sensitive to the effect of some uncertainties in proper motions and cepheid ages.
